How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lansing?

Lansing Apartments
Bed Type Average Rent Range
Studio $900 $250 - $1,450
1BR $940 $680 - $1,430
2BR $1,050 $750 - $1,650
3BR $1,530 $1,250 - $2,440
4+BR $1,580 $1,360 - $2,800

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million Rentable list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
